Stainless Steel 440B Explained

Stainless Steel 440B is a high-carbon martensitic stainless steel positioned between 440A and 440C in terms of hardness, wear resistance, and corrosion performance. It delivers higher strength and edge retention than 440A while maintaining better toughness and corrosion resistance than 440C. After proper heat treatment, SS 440B achieves excellent mechanical stability and abrasion resistance, making it suitable for demanding cutting and mechanical applications. Grade 440B is commonly used in industrial knives, valve components, bearings, surgical tools, and precision parts where balanced performance and long service life are required.

440B STAINLESS STEEL ROUND BAR EQUIVALENT GRADES

STANDARD UNS WNR.
SS 440B S44003 1.4112

CHEMICAL COMPOSITION OF STAINLESS STEEL 440B ROUND BAR

Grade C % Mn % Si % P % S % Cr % Ni %
440B 0.60 – 0.75 1.00 max 1.00 max 0.040 max 0.030 max 16.0 – 18.0

MECHANICAL PROPERTIES OF STAINLESS STEEL 440B ROUND BAR

Tempering Temperature (°C) Tensile Strength (MPa) Yield Strength 0.2% Proof (MPa) Elongation (% in 50 mm) Hardness Rockwell C (HRC) Impact Charpy V (J)
Annealed* 758 448 14 269 HB max
204 2030 1900 4 59 9
260 1960 1830 4 57 9
316 1860 1740 4 56 9
371 1790 1660 4 56 9
* Annealed properties are typical for Condition A of ASTM A276. Brinell hardness shown is the ASTM A276 specified maximum for annealed 440B.

Applications of Stainless Steel 440B Round Bars

Stainless Steel 440B round bars are widely used in tooling, mechanical engineering, power transmission, pump manufacturing, and industrial equipment where strength, wear resistance, and operational stability are essential.

  • Tooling & Cutting Equipment: Industrial knives, cutters, shear parts, hardened pins.
  • Mechanical & Power Transmission: Bearings, rollers, shafts, wear components.
  • Pumps & Valves: Valve stems, pump shafts, mechanical seals.
